We are your Parish church in London Colney and are one of three hundred and thirty five parishes that make up the Diocese of St Albans. Recently turning two hundred years old, St Peter’s has been serving the needs of London Colney for a long time and is proud to be able to continue to do so into the 21st Century. Who We Are In Ministry
Our new Vicar, Revd Tom Smith, was Collated, Inducted and Installed on 8th June 2024. Tom joins our Ministry team made up of Associate Priest, Revd Philip Green and our Lay Reader, Rosie Rawlinson. Together they bring a wide and varied leadership to our worship, together with a wealth of church and life experience that equips them to meet any Pastoral challenge that may present itself. Do join us at one of our regular services. There are two held on Sundays – 8am and 10am, with a quieter midweek service at 10am on Wednesdays.
